If you are passionate about social justice, self-motivated and would like to be part of a dynamic team working to enhance public participation in and transparency of Parliament and positively influence society, joining PMG could be the opportunity you have been looking for.

Opportunity closing date: 26 November 2021
Location: Cape Town-based position
Opportunity type: Employment

The job will include the following and the successful candidate must have proven experience and skills in these areas:

  • Identifying story angles, interviewing, researching, distilling key messages and writing up content
  • Media liaison – responding to media requests
  • Representing the organisation at public events
  • Website content management: Producing content and updating website
  • Social media management
  • Moderating comments
  • Build, collaborate and maintain relationships with key stakeholders
  • Teaching, training, and public education including presentation
  • Contributing to funding reports
  • Editing and proofreading
  • Carrying out any additional responsibilities that may be assigned by the Executive Director

Furthermore, we expect the successful candidate to be a skilled project manager, able to deliver projects and accompanying deliverables on time and with high quality. Candidates should demonstrate a keen interest for, and proven experience in politics, human rights and policy.

Requirements:

  • Relevant Degree
  • At least 2 years of relevant work experience related to the above listed areas
  • Excellent English written, presentation and verbal communication skills (media and public speaking skills are critical)
  • Highly computer literate and good knowledge of Canva  & other design programmes
  • Experience in producing video and audio content will be an advantage

Further Requirements:

  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ively
  • Ability to be flexible about work responsibilities, prioritise and thrive under pressure or Excellent organisational skills with experience of managing multiple tasks and prioritizing effectively.
  • Problem-solving and analytical skills, well-organised, attention to detail and quality, and a structured and pro-active working style
  • South African

Please forward a comprehensive 2-page CV and covering letter, including a certified copy of your ID and three references to [email protected] by 26 November 2021
No late applications will be considered.

Salary: R17500 per month (excl benefits)
